News18 India is an Indian Media television channel owned by

Jagran Prakashan Limited
and acquired in 2006 by Network 18 and rebranded IBN7. In 2016 it took its current name. In 2013, News18 India launched, on channel 520 on the UK's Sky TV platform News18, a live version of the parent channel.[1]

Popular shows

  • Aar Paar

Aar Paar is Hindi news show which aired daily at 7pm having Amish Devgan as anchor.[2]

  • Ham to puchhenge

It runs daily at 8 pm.
